OSS Technician

Location: Birmingham, England, United Kingdom
Job schedule: Full time
Office-based with travel to Stafford and Glasgow as needed

Responsibilities

  • Diagnose and resolve IT‑related hardware and software issues efficiently.
  • Ensure user computers are delivered in a ready‑to‑use condition.
  • Provide ad‑hoc training to users on common issues and self‑service tools.
  • Manage the physical stock of devices and accessories, updating the Configuration Management Database (CMDB).
  • Conduct regular inventory checks for relevant hardware.
  • Coordinate logistics for transporting and relocating devices between locations.
  • Handle warranty cases in collaboration with OEM vendors.
  • Identify and report risks that could impact OSS service quality.
  • Offer support to end users and maintain IT equipment and software functionality in meeting rooms and collaboration areas.
  • Perform routine checks of computer rooms, monitoring temperature, air conditioning, cabling, and general functionality.
  • Adhere to OSS governance, including participation in meetings and following escalation processes.
  • Follow OSS procedures as outlined in Runbooks, SOPs, and knowledge articles.

Qualifications

  • Formal qualification in IT from an accredited university or college, or completion of an IT apprenticeship.
  • Excellent communication skills in written and verbal form, with the ability to engage both business and technical audiences in both the local language and English.
  • Proactive and solution‑oriented mindset.
  • Demonstrated ability to work independently and self‑drive tasks.
  • Legal authorization to work in the United Kingdom.
